Strategies of different companies in maximizing revenue, saving costs, and prioritizing growth and expansion.
10:54
Uber focuses on maximizing revenue with its large market share.
Swiggy prioritizes saving costs as they move towards profitability and an IPO.
Ked prioritizes growth and expansion over revenue generation.
Importance of setting clear goals and metrics to define impact emphasized for all companies.

Importance of focusing on metrics and KPIs for improving business outcomes.
18:42
Reducing driver cancels can lead to lower ride cancels and increased revenue generation.
Increasing referral rates is a cost-effective customer acquisition strategy compared to traditional marketing methods.
Referral users have a strong relationship with product usage, resulting in higher customer engagement and lower acquisition costs.
Optimizing metrics is crucial for driving business growth strategically.
Ways to Improve Referral Rates and Acquire New Customers.
22:35
Lack of awareness about the referral program is a common reason why users may not refer others.
The issue can be resolved by making the program more discoverable in the app or running marketing campaigns.
Utilizing the structure of feature KPI, product or team KPI, company KPI, and company goal can help improve referral rates.
Increasing the discoverability of the referral feature can lead to a higher referral rate and more active customers.

Incentivizing completion of steps within 21 days with a €50 bonus and rewards for friend referrals.
31:56
Bonus expires if steps are not completed within the specified timeframe.
Understanding rewards leads to fewer customer support queries, saving costs and increasing customer satisfaction.
Collaboration between product teams is essential for achieving customer support key performance indicators (KPIs).
Feature KPIs such as screen views and click-through rates indicate the success of features, while reduction in support tickets confirms feature effectiveness.
